Robert H. Gyhra  “Bob” was born June 5, 1937 in Pawnee City to Leonard and Adelaide (Rucker) Gyhra and passed away July 28, 2016, at the Pawnee County Memorial Hospital in Pawnee City, Nebraska at the age of 79 years and 53 days.  He was the third of 10 children in the family.  

He grew up on the family farm southeast of Steinauer.  He attended St. Anthony’s grade school then attended high school in Steinauer and graduated in 1955.  He was a member of the US Naval Air Reserves from 1954-1962.  After graduation he attended Benedictine College for one year and attended Peru State College for another year.  He then moved to Omaha and worked at Mutual of Omaha as an actuary.  While in Omaha he played on 3 different baseball teams.  He would even change uniforms in the backseat of the car while Erma drove from one game to the next, often times running to join the game!

While in Omaha, he met Erma Wemhoff and on November 19, 1960 (Erma’s birthday), they were married at St. Mary’s Catholic Church outside of Humphrey and were married 55 years.  To this marriage five girls were born, Teresa, Suzanne, Jane, Peggy and Amy.  He was never sorry that he didn’t have any boys, however he did tell the girls once when they were throwing softballs that, “You throw like a bunch of girls!”  Or that if we ate this “we would grow hair on our chest!”  We all looked at each other wondering what to do!

They moved to Steinauer in July 1964 when Bob started working at the Bank of Steinauer and The B.J. Steinauer Agency.  In 1980 along with Charles Jasa, he purchased the bank and agency where they were Vice-President & President respectively until their retirement on December 31, 1999.  He remained on the Board of Directors until his death.  

Bob was a lifetime member of St. Anthony’s Catholic Church in Steinauer.  He was very active in the church over the years as a member of the church board, lector and he loved singing in the choir.  He served as Mayor of Steinauer from 1967 – 2015 and was on the Steinauer VFD during that time.  He was proud to serve on the Pawnee Medical Foundation for 32 years and Pawnee Hospital Board for 29 years.  He also served on the Pawnee Area Regional Revolving Loan Fund Board along with other various boards and committees. 

He loved golfing, bowling, fishing, hunting, gardening, mowing and doing odd jobs for the church and community “just because.”  He enjoyed going to his grandkids sporting events and activities, traveling with Erma and his family and playing cards at the tavern.   Basically, he loved going and doing “things!”  His love and loyalty for the church, his family and community will be hard to replace and he will be missed.
